Isabell Mckenzie 1723–1768 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 22 Mar 1723

Birth Location: Argyllshire, Scotland

Death Date: 1768

Death Location: Argyllshire, Scotland

Father: John Mckenzie

Mother: Mary Sutherland

Spouse(s): John McCorquodale

Children(s): Florence McCorquodale

The story of Isabell Mckenzie began in 1723 in Argyllshire, Scotland. Isabell Mckenzie married John Mccorquodale, and had children including Florence Mccorquodale. Isabell Mckenzie passed away in 1768 in Argyllshire, Scotland.
